This appendix explains the required disk space for the performance management with ETERNUS SF Manager.
When the performance management is being performed, based on the fibre channel switch used to collect the performance information, the type of ETERNUS Disk storage system, the number of logical units involved, the number of Disk Enclosures (DEs), and the number of days for which information is to be collected, the required capacity given below becomes necessary.
Information
The default number of days for collection is seven. The number of secured Logical Units (LUs) is the actual number of LUs the functions of which are secured in order to perform performance management for the ETERNUS Disk storage systems. Performance management is secured in units of 64 LUN for the ETERNUS Disk storage systems. Therefore, when instructed to secure from LUN 15 to 200, the information for the actual LUs 0 to 255 (256 in total) would be secured.

Additionally, when performance information is output using the performance information operation command, the following disk space is required, depending on the number of LUs of ETERNUS Disk storage system and Fibre Channel switches, number of DEs, number of ports that is used to collect performance information, and number of days of performance information output.
Each element (number of installed CM CPUs, number of installed DEs, installed CA Ports, installed CM Ports, LUs, RAIDGroups, and installed FC Ports) is the number mounted in the device when the command is executed.
